Step-by-Step: How to Put on Wrist Wraps for Lifting
- Unroll the Wrist Wrap: Begin by fully unrolling your wrist wrap. Locate the thumb loop at one end and place it around your thumb.
- Wrap Around the Wrist: Start wrapping the fabric around your wrist snugly, but not too tight. Make 2–3 wraps depending on the length.
- Secure and Adjust: Once wrapped, fasten the Velcro to secure the wrap. Adjust to your desired tightness—you should feel supported but still flexible.
- Thumb Loop (Optional): Some lifters prefer to remove the thumb loop after securing the wrap. It’s optional based on comfort and movement needs.
Why Wrist Wraps Are Important for Lifting
Lifting heavy weights puts significant strain on your wrists, and without proper support, this can lead to discomfort or injury. Wrist wraps for lifting provide compression and stabilization to the wrist joint, helping you maintain control and proper form during heavy lifts.
By wrapping your wrists correctly, you protect yourself from injury and can push your limits safely.
When to Use Wrist Wraps During Your Workout
Wrist wraps aren’t needed for every part of your training. They’re most effective during heavy compound lifts like bench press, overhead press, or clean and jerk—any movement where your wrists are under pressure. Avoid overusing them on warm-up sets or light weights to help maintain natural wrist strength and mobility.

Choosing the Right Wrist Wrap Length and Type
Wrist wraps come in several lengths—like 12", 18", and 24". Shorter wraps are ideal for quick workouts or CrossFit, offering flexibility.
